Incident Overview

Description
LATAM flight LA800, a Boeing 787-9 Dreamliner, CC-BGG, entered a sudden descent while cruising over the Tasman Sea. The flight continued to Auckland Airport (AKL), New Zealand. As a result, 3 cabin crew members and 10 passengers were injured to varying degrees (1 cabin crew member, 2 passengers were hospitalised due to the seriousness of their injuries). At the time of the occurrence, the aircraft was established at FL410. The left-hand cockpit seat initiated an involuntary forward movement. The recovery of the aircraft by the flight crew from the subsequent involuntary descent condition of approximately 400 feet did not exceed the positive or negative loads allowed by the manufacturer for this type of flight condition. Weather conditions and the lack of turbulence on the route at the time of the occurrence were not causal or contributing factors in the operation. In August 2024 the FAA’s issued an airworthiness directive to inspect the captain?s and first officer?s seats on 787-7, 787-9, and 787-10 airplanes for missing or cracked rocker switch caps or for cracked switch cover assemblies within 30 days.
